Why do people donate so much money to temple instead of charities or orphanages?

It has a personal individual reason to list out.
Donating to Temple signifies one’s faith and to the orphanage signifies their humanity. Both are the precious virtues one must-have. Why a man chooses his faith over humanity has its very individual reasoning. It is not the Temple alone that collects donations, other holy places gather it as a charity. Both temples and orphanages have the same purpose with different names. Some temples send food to the orphanages. Many people are not aware that temples even have trusts sponsoring the education for the underprivileged.

